Start With Buyer Intent: What You Need to Hire for
Choosing a partner for brand strategy should begin with your buyer intent: are you trying to clarify positioning, sharpen messaging, or accelerate a product launch? If you’re preparing to introduce something new, you need strategy that connects market insight to go-to-market decisions, not just a best brand strategy agency refreshed look. If you’re already selling but struggling to stand out, prioritize research, competitive mapping, and a narrative that improves conversion across channels. The right engagement aligns deliverables with your commercial goals so you can measure impact.
Before you request proposals, list your current bottlenecks in plain language. For example, you might have strong awareness but weak differentiation, inconsistent messaging across teams, or confusing value propositions for channel partners. Those symptoms point to specific capabilities such as segmentation, brand architecture, and messaging frameworks. When you know what “better” means, you can evaluate agencies by their approach to diagnosis, not just their past successes.
What Strong Brand Strategy Deliverables Look Like
A credible brand strategy partner produces more than high-level ideas; it creates usable assets your team can execute. Look for a structured process that includes customer and category research, insights synthesis, competitive benchmarking, and clear positioning recommendations. You should expect product launch marketing agency tangible outputs like a positioning statement, core messaging pillars, brand voice guidance, and a rationale your stakeholders can defend. Ask how they translate insights into decisions for packaging, website, sales enablement, and campaign concepts.
For teams with complex offerings, deliverables should also include brand architecture and product-line guidance. That ensures each SKU or offering has a consistent role in the portfolio while avoiding overlap and internal confusion. If you operate in regulated or crowded categories, credible strategy should address compliance-friendly messaging and claims substantiation considerations. Ultimately, the best work reduces friction across marketing, sales, and product teams by setting clear direction for how your brand shows up everywhere.
